'Nomadland' wins PGA Award, cementing front-runner status

This image released by Searchlight Pictures shows Frances McDormand, left, and and David Strathairn in a scene from the film "Nomadland." (Searchlight Pictures via AP)NEW YORK – Chloé Zhao's “Nomadland" cemented its Oscar front-runner status Wednesday, winning the top award at the 32nd annual Producers Guild of America Awards. But if any film could claim that mantle, it's “Nomadland,” winner of the Golden Globe best picture award for drama. The PGA Awards are watched especially closely as an Oscar bellwether. The producers use the same preferential ballot as the film academy, and their best-picture fields often nearly mirror each other.

Golden Globes group gives $5.1 million in grants

Kidman was among the entertainers who appeared to discuss the charities that benefit from HFPA grants. More than $5.1 million in funds were given to over 70 nonprofit organizations during the “HFPA Philanthropy: Empowering the Next Generation” virtual event on Tuesday. The event, formerly known as the Grants Banquet, celebrated some of the organizations with aspiring artists, filmmakers and storytellers. The organization is known for putting on the Golden Globes. Salma Hayek paid homage to the Las Fotos Project, a nonprofit organization that inspires teenage girls through photography.

Politically charged 'black-ish' episode gets belated home

LOS ANGELES A politically charged episode of black-ish from 2017 that was shelved by ABC has found a home on Hulu, a corporate sibling of the Disney-owned broadcast network. I cannot wait for everyone to finally see the episode for themselves, series creator Kenya Barris posted Monday on social media. The change of heart comes amid ongoing protests and calls for broad social change prompted by the death in May of George Floyd, a Black man, while in Minneapolis police custody. The Emmy-nominated series has tackled thorny social issues during its ABC run, which began in 2014. Black-ish has four nominations for next month's Emmys on ABC, including lead actor nods for Anderson and Ross.

2020 Met Gala theme revealed

Gwen Stefani, Jeremy Scott, Bella Hadid, Stella Maxwell, Maluma, Sarah Paulson, Tracee Ellis Ross, Denek K, and Violet Chachki attend The 2019 Met Gala "Celebrating Camp: Notes on Fashion" at Metropolitan Museum of Art on May 6, 2019, in New(CNN) - The Metropolitan Museum of Art of New York City has announced the theme of the 2020 Met Gala and the accompanying Costume Institute exhibition: "About Time: Fashion and Duration." The exhibition itself will run from May 7 to Sept. 7, while the gala will be held the evening of May 4. "Fashion is indelibly connected to time," Andrew Bolton, curator of the exhibition, said in a statement. Through a series of chronologies, the exhibition will use the concept of duration to analyze the temporal twists and turns of fashion history." The gala will be co-chaired by Nicolas Ghesquire of Louis Vuitton, Lin-Manuel Miranda, Emma Stone, Meryl Streep, and Anna Wintour.
